Local Soldier promoted to Specialist in MONG

Spc. Natalie DuBois receives her new rank patch from 1st Lt. Tamir Middleton, commander of the 1140th Forward Support Engineer Battalion.

Cape Girardeau, Mo. -- Natalie DuBois, of Cape Girardeau, was recently promoted to specialist in the 1140th Forward Support Engineer Battalion.

DuBois has served in the Missouri National Guard for a year and was surprised to receive the promotion so soon.

"I didn't think it would happen as soon as it did," said DuBois. "But I am very excited and ready to show my unit what I can do. I'm so grateful for the chance and encouragement to make me be a better Soldier."

1st Sgt. Haskel Rooker was impressed with DuBois' work ethic and was proud to promote such a deserving Soldier.

"She's a good Soldier," said Rooker. "She has a fantastic attitude and is willing to complete any task given to her. She has a lot of potential in her military career and life."

DuBois is the daughter of Pierre and Beckey Dubois, of Cape Girardeau. She is a graduate of Jackson High School and is currently attending Metro Business College. She lives and works in Cape Girardeau.
